you did thank you, I'm confussed with your sizing but I will go tts 10.5 when I search for those hanon 1500s, I heard gripes about the nice kicks model, but I now know why the hanon 1500I only started getting 1500s last year. Started with NiceKicks grey/red pair and thought they were awesome. Then I got the 2 Crooked Tongues (Made In England) collabs and I thought they were great, I instantly realized why everyone was complaining about the shape of the NiceKicks. Then I got the Hanon CHF and I was convinced that the Crooked tongues shape was not a proper representation of a good 1500 shape either. The Hanons are absolutely perfect. It seems like NB is back on track with made in England 1500s since the Hanons.
I never truly understood why dudes would complain so much about shape until i had a few different 1500 in front of me. Even the difference between the CT and Hanon was a shocker considering they are both made in England.
Even the sizing was all off and they all fit similar and comfy
Nicekicks = sz 11
CT = sz 11.5 (my usual nb USA size)
Hanon = sz 12 (my true size for everything else)
Not sure if i answered your question, but i figured i`d share.
